    Internal Gear Grinding for Seamless Performance

    Internal gear also often calls ring gears ,it’s mainly used in planetary gearboxes . The ring gear refers to the internal gear on the same axis as the planet carrier in the planetary gear transmission. It is a key component in the transmission system used to convey the transmission function. It is composed of a flange half-coupling with external teeth and an inner gear ring with the same number of teeth. It is mainly used to start the motor transmission system. Internal gear can be machined by,shaping ,by broaching ,by skiving ,by grinding.

    power skiving internal ring gear for planetary gearbox

    The helical internal ring gear was produced by power skiving craft ,For small module internal ring gear we often suggest to do power skiving instead of broaching plus grinding ,since power skiving is more stable and also has high Efficiency ,it takes 2-3 minutes for one gear ,accuracy could be ISO5-6 before heat treat and ISO6 after heat treatment .

    Module:0.45

    Teeth :108

    Material :42CrMo plus QT ,

    Heat Treatment :Nitriding

    Accuracy: DIN6

    DIN6 internal helical gear housing in high precision gears

    DIN6 is the accuracy of the internal helical gear . Usually we have two ways to meet high accuracy .

    1) Hobbing + grinding for internal gear

    2) Power skiving for internal gear

    However for small internal helical gear ,hobbing is not easy to process ,so normally we would do power skiving to meet the high accuracy and also high efficiency .For big internal helical gear ,we will use hobbing plus grinding method . After power skiving or grinding ,middle carton steel like 42CrMo will do nitriding to increase the hardness and resistance

    Internal Spur Gear And Helical Gear For Planetary Speed Reducer

    These internal spur gears and internal helical gears are used in planetary speed reducer for construction machinery. Material are middle carbon alloy steel . Internal gears usually could be done by either broaching or skiving ,for big internal gears sometimes produced by hobbing method as well .Broaching internal gears could meet accuracy ISO8-9 ,skiving internal gears could meet accuracy ISO5-7 .If do grinding ,the accuracy could meet ISO5-6.
